The Advantages of OEM Floor Formwork Systems


In the construction industry, the efficiency and quality of building processes play a crucial role in determining project success. One of the key components that contribute to this effectiveness is formwork, particularly in flooring applications. Original Equipment Manufacturer (OEM) floor formwork systems have emerged as a reliable solution for contractors looking to maximize productivity while ensuring structural integrity. In this article, we will explore the benefits of using OEM floor formwork, highlighting its impact on modern construction practices.


1. Customization and Flexibility


One of the primary advantages of OEM floor formwork is the high degree of customization it offers. Unlike traditional formwork systems, OEM solutions can be tailored to meet specific project requirements, including dimensions, load capacity, and architectural designs. This flexibility allows contractors to achieve a high level of precision during the construction phase, minimizing waste and ensuring that the final product aligns with design specifications.


Moreover, OEM manufacturers often have extensive experience in working with diverse construction projects. This expertise enables them to provide valuable insights and recommendations that further enhance the effectiveness of the formwork solution. As a result, contractors can feel confident that they are using the most appropriate system for their unique requirements.


2. Improved Speed of Installation


Time is a critical factor in construction projects, and OEM floor formwork systems significantly improve installation speed. These systems are designed for quick assembly and disassembly, enabling construction teams to set up and take down formwork with minimal downtime. This is particularly advantageous in large-scale projects where delaying one aspect of construction can lead to cascading delays across the entire schedule.


By utilizing modular components designed for easy interlocking, OEM formwork speeds up the entire process, allowing contractors to complete tasks efficiently and move on to subsequent phases of construction. This efficiency not only reduces labor costs but also accelerates project timelines, which is vital for meeting tight deadlines.


3. Enhanced Safety Standards


Safety is paramount in construction, and OEM floor formwork helps uphold high safety standards. Many OEM formwork systems are designed with built-in safety features, such as guardrails and stabilizing components, which reduce the risk of accidents on-site. Properly designed formwork also minimizes the likelihood of structural failures during the curing process of concrete, ensuring that workers can operate with reduced risk.

Moreover, the use of standardized components across projects simplifies training for new employees and temporary workers, as they can quickly learn how to handle the equipment safely. As organizations seek to promote a culture of safety, OEM formwork contributes significantly to creating a secure working environment, therefore safeguarding both workers and the overall integrity of the project.


4. Cost Efficiency


While upfront costs are always a consideration, OEM floor formwork can lead to significant cost savings over the long term. The precise engineering and efficient designs help reduce material wastage and increase the lifespan of the formwork itself. Because OEM solutions often streamline the construction process, they can lead to lower labor costs due to reduced man-hours on-site.


Additionally, some OEM manufacturers provide full lifecycle support, which means that they offer maintenance and servicing for their products. This can further decrease long-term costs, as reducing the need for replacements among underperforming formwork systems can result in substantial savings.


5. Sustainability and Environmental Impact


The construction sector is increasingly emphasizing sustainability, and OEM floor formwork aligns well with these efforts. Many manufacturers are committed to using sustainable materials and production techniques, which can significantly reduce the environmental footprint of construction projects. By utilizing reusable and recyclable components, OEM formwork supports sustainability goals while helping to minimize waste generated during construction.


Furthermore, the efficiency gained through the use of OEM systems can lead to faster project completion times, thereby reducing overall energy consumption and resource usage. This proactive approach to environmental stewardship helps meet regulatory requirements while appealing to a market increasingly conscious of its ecological impact.


Conclusion


OEM floor formwork systems represent a revolutionary advancement in construction methodologies, offering tailored solutions that enhance project efficiency, safety, and sustainability. The benefits of improved installation speeds, customizability, and long-term cost savings make OEM formwork an attractive option for modern builders. As the construction industry continues to evolve, embracing innovative technologies like OEM formwork will be essential in meeting future challenges and sustaining growth.
